物理机服务器如何连接ssh
-
连接物理机服务器的SSH,可以通过以下步骤进行:
-
确保你已经有一台运行SSH服务的物理机服务器。如果你还没有安装SSH服务器,可以使用如下命令来安装(以Ubuntu为例):
sudo apt-get update sudo apt-get install openssh-server -
打开你的终端,使用SSH命令连接到物理机服务器,命令格式如下:
ssh username@server_ip_address其中,
username是你在物理机服务器上的用户名,server_ip_address是你的物理机服务器的IP地址。例如,如果你的用户名是admin,物理机服务器的IP地址是192.168.0.100,则命令如下:ssh admin@192.168.0.100当你执行以上命令后,系统会提示你输入你在物理机服务器上的密码。输入密码后,你就可以成功连接到物理机服务器的SSH。
-
你也可以使用其他选项来指定连接的端口、身份验证方法等。例如,如果你的物理机服务器的SSH服务监听在非默认端口22上,可以使用如下格式的命令:
ssh -p port_number username@server_ip_address其中,
port_number是你物理机服务器上SSH服务监听的端口号。
以上就是连接物理机服务器的SSH的基本步骤。请注意,为了安全起见,确保你的物理机服务器上的SSH服务设置了适当的安全措施,如使用公钥身份验证、设置限制登录用户等。
1年前 -
-
物理机服务器通过SSH(Secure Shell)连接可以实现远程访问和管理服务器的目的。下面是物理机服务器连接SSH的步骤:
-
确认SSH是否已安装:在物理机服务器上确认是否已安装了SSH。如果没有安装,需要使用操作系统提供的包管理工具(如apt、yum等)安装SSH服务。
-
开启SSH服务:在物理机服务器上启动SSH服务。具体方法可能会根据操作系统版本而有所不同,一般可以通过命令行执行以下命令:
- Ubuntu/Debian:sudo service ssh start
- CentOS/Fedora:sudo systemctl start sshd
- Windows:在服务管理器中找到"OpenSSH SSH Server"并将其启动。
-
防火墙设置:如果物理机服务器上启用了防火墙,需要确保SSH服务的相关端口(默认为22)在防火墙中被允许通过。可以使用防火墙管理工具(如iptables、ufw等)打开SSH端口。
-
获取物理机服务器的IP地址:在物理机服务器上执行ifconfig命令(Linux/Unix)或ipconfig命令(Windows),获取服务器的IP地址。记住这个IP地址,后面将会用到。
-
远程连接SSH:使用SSH客户端工具连接到物理机服务器。可以使用以下命令来连接物理机服务器:
- 在Linux/Unix系统上:ssh user@ip_address
- 在Windows系统上:使用提供的SSH客户端工具(如PuTTY)来连接到物理机服务器。输入服务器的IP地址和登录凭证(用户名和密码)。
-
登录物理机服务器:输入正确的用户名和密码,进行身份验证。如果身份验证成功,将会进入物理机服务器的命令行界面。
一旦成功连接到物理机服务器的SSH服务,您就可以使用命令行执行各种操作,如文件管理、软件安装、配置更改等。注意要使用高强度的密码或使用SSH密钥对进行身份验证来增强安全性。另外,如果您要远程访问多个物理机服务器,可以将SSH配置为使用不同的端口,以避免冲突和提高安全性。
1年前 -
-
物理机服务器连接SSH的方法和操作流程如下:
-
确保服务器已连接到网络:
- 检查服务器的网络连接状态,确保服务器已连接到Internet或局域网。
-
启用SSH服务:
- 在服务器上安装和启动SSH服务。这通常需要root权限。
- 在大多数Linux发行版中,可以使用以下命令安装OpenSSH服务器:
sudo apt-get install openssh-server # Ubuntu/Debian sudo yum install openssh-server # CentOS/RHEL sudo zypper install openssh-server # openSUSE - 在Windows服务器上,可以在“添加或删除程序”中安装OpenSSH服务器组件。
-
配置SSH服务:
- 默认情况下,SSH服务器使用标准端口22。如果需要修改端口号,可以修改SSH服务器配置文件。
- 对于Linux服务器,配置文件通常是
/etc/ssh/sshd_config。 - 对于Windows服务器,可以在“Windows PowerShell”或“命令提示符”中使用命令
notepad C:\ProgramData\ssh\sshd_config来编辑配置文件。 - 在配置文件中找到
Port字段,并将其修改为所需的端口号。保存配置文件并关闭。
-
配置防火墙规则:
- 如果服务器上启用了防火墙,必须确保允许通过SSH连接的流量。
- 在Linux服务器上,可以使用iptables或firewalld配置防火墙规则。示例命令如下:
sudo iptables -A INPUT -p tcp --dport <SSH端口号> -j ACCEPT sudo systemctl restart iptables - 对于Windows服务器,可以使用“Windows Defender防火墙”或第三方防火墙软件配置防火墙规则。
-
连接SSH:
- 将SSH客户端(如OpenSSH、PuTTY等)安装到本地电脑上。
- 打开SSH客户端,并输入服务器的IP地址和SSH端口号。
- 输入服务器的用户名和密码进行身份验证。
-
配置SSH密钥身份验证(可选):
- 使用SSH密钥对进行身份验证可以提高安全性。
- 生成SSH密钥对,并将公钥部署到服务器上。
- 在服务器上配置SSH服务以允许公钥身份验证。
- 在本地电脑上配置SSH客户端以使用私钥进行身份验证。
以上是连接物理机服务器的SSH方法和操作流程,根据实际情况可以进行调整和修改。
1年前 -